1. Mindler – Personalized Career Roadmaps for Students

Mindler focuses on school and college students. It combines artificial intelligence with human expertise to deliver deep career insights. The platform offers five-dimensional assessments covering personality, aptitude, interest, emotional intelligence, and orientation style.

Once users complete the test, Mindler recommends career paths aligned with their strengths. Certified career coaches guide students through detailed career roadmaps, including subject selection, entrance exams, and suitable colleges.

Key Features

  • Psychometric assessments for students from grades 8 to 12
  • Personalized career reports
  • One-on-one sessions with certified counselors
  • Parent engagement and planning support
  • Courses, college recommendations, and scholarships

Best For: Students seeking structured career planning.


2. CareerGuide – One of India’s Most Comprehensive Career Portals

CareerGuide serves both students and working professionals. The platform hosts a variety of career tests based on psychometric principles. Users can explore fields like engineering, design, law, hospitality, and management.

CareerGuide assigns experienced counselors for personalized advice. It also offers free career webinars, skill-building programs, and industry-specific insights.

Key Features

  • Industry-recognized career tests
  • Phone and video counseling sessions
  • Resume and LinkedIn profile reviews
  • Courses for career counselors and educators
  • Access to articles and career discovery tools

Best For: High schoolers, college students, and career switchers.


3. iDreamCareer – Trusted by Schools and Governments

iDreamCareer partners with schools, government programs, and NGOs to provide career guidance at scale. The platform offers a mix of online assessments, expert mentoring, and content libraries with information on over 500 career paths.

Students receive guidance on entrance exams, scholarships, and global education. The platform also supports international education seekers, offering help with applications and university selection.

Key Features

  • Psychometric assessments validated by education experts
  • Live career mentoring with industry specialists
  • Career information on 1,000+ occupations
  • Access to global education and scholarships
  • Support in 10+ regional languages

Best For: Students in urban and rural settings needing multilingual support.


4. Shiksha.com Career Guidance Tool – Powered by Naukri

Shiksha.com, part of Info Edge (which also owns Naukri.com), offers a career guidance tool for college aspirants. It evaluates preferences and abilities, then recommends suitable undergraduate programs and colleges.

Since the platform links to college listings and reviews, students can directly apply or compare institutions. Shiksha also offers webinars, career FAQs, and expert advice columns.

Key Features

  • UG program discovery tool
  • College match recommendations
  • Integrated Naukri.com job insights
  • Entrance exam tracking and alerts
  • Live sessions with education consultants

Best For: Students looking for degree-specific and college-focused guidance.


5. Upkey – Career Development for Global Students and Graduates

Upkey helps students prepare for the workforce. It offers virtual internships, resume creation tools, and leadership courses. Students can explore career paths in business, tech, healthcare, and more.

Upkey’s programs focus on skills like communication, personal branding, and professional networking. Users can also connect with mentors and explore practical case-based learning modules.

Key Features

  • Free virtual internships with certificates
  • Resume builder with AI guidance
  • Leadership and career prep courses
  • Real-world business challenges and feedback
  • Global access for international students

Best For: Students seeking hands-on experience before job hunting.


6. MapMyTalent – A Scientific Career Discovery Tool

MapMyTalent uses neuroscience and psychology to guide users toward the right career path. It features aptitude and personality tests that analyze brain functions and behavioral tendencies. The platform creates a personalized career report and connects users with certified mentors.

Parents also receive detailed input on how to support their child’s career decisions. The platform encourages long-term planning, rather than quick decisions based on trends.

Key Features

  • Aptitude, personality, and brain function analysis
  • Personalized career suggestions
  • Counseling by psychologists and career mentors
  • Career path planning with a 10-year roadmap
  • Report cards for parents

Best For: Science-driven career decisions for students and parents.


7. Talerang – Focus on Employability and Workplace Readiness

Talerang offers programs for college students and fresh graduates who want to prepare for the workplace. The platform trains users in business communication, interview prep, email etiquette, and teamwork. It also connects learners with companies offering internships and job roles.

Unlike traditional counseling services, Talerang simulates a real work environment through live projects. It has collaborated with top companies and B-schools to provide industry-backed career guidance.

Key Features

  • Live business projects
  • Soft skills and corporate training
  • Direct internship/job placement assistance
  • Certification from corporate mentors
  • Alumni mentorship network

Best For: Fresh graduates aiming for workplace readiness.


8. Univariety – School-Aligned Career Counseling

Univariety partners with schools to deliver structured career guidance programs. It empowers students from grades 8 to 12 with interest-based assessments and academic planning. The platform integrates guidance counselors within school systems and tracks student progress over the years.

Students can explore global careers, attend webinars, and access a large database of courses and colleges.

Key Features

  • School-wide career planning framework
  • Counselor-led career sessions
  • Parental engagement modules
  • College readiness and application tools
  • Alumni engagement for real-world feedback

Best For: Schools seeking an end-to-end solution for student guidance.


How to Choose the Right Platform

Choosing the right career counseling platform depends on individual goals. Consider these factors:

  1. Your Age and Stage:
    • School students should look for psychometric assessments and subject guidance.
    • College students need help with career paths and internships.
    • Working professionals should seek platforms with transition and upskilling options.
  2. Type of Support Needed:
    • Some users need assessments.
    • Others prefer mentorship or real-world training.
    • Some require guidance on college admissions or international careers.
  3. Availability of Experts:
    • Choose platforms offering access to experienced mentors, not just automated reports.
  4. Affordability and Access:
    • Many platforms offer free resources, but premium services often provide deeper guidance.
    • Look for flexible plans if cost is a concern.
